Output b884e5931038fb33d40a3158795c87aeec8782b5f56cedc9f388e1cfd1be1321:0

value
70656550
script pubkey
OP_0 OP_PUSHBYTES_20 d6b9ed9389156ef5b2fe14ad7cb56562a5d8e303
address
tb1q66u7myufz4h0tvh7zjkhedt9v2ja3ccrylh2sd
transaction
b884e5931038fb33d40a3158795c87aeec8782b5f56cedc9f388e1cfd1be1321
confirmations
111042
spent
true